C语言变量和函数命名规范

变量名规则
第一个字母: 局部 l、 全局 g
第二个字母: bit(bt)、 bool(b)、 char(c)、 int(i)、 short(s)、 long(l)、 unsigned(u)、 double(d)、 float(f)、
       pointer(p)、 enum(st)、 struct(st)、 union(st)
例子:

int liWidth;
           struct Person gstPerson;
           char gcUsedFlag;
           bool gbIsOk;
驼峰命名法: myFirstName、 myLastName,这样的变量名看上去就像骆驼峰一样此起彼伏,故
而得名。
函数名规则
函数名一般应该以一个动词开始, 以一个名词结束, 这种方法符合英语的一般规则。
下面列出了几个命名比较合适的函数:
                                                 PrintReports();
                                                 SpawnUtilityProgram();
                                                 ExitSystem();
                                                 Initia|izeDisk();
分类词后面加_的命名方式如下:
                                         StubAPS_ProcessEvent();
                                         StubAPS_SetInterPanChannel();
                                         SampleApp_Init();
                                         SampleApp_ProcessEvent();

原文地址:https://www.cnblogs.com/qinzhou/p/8250927.html

时间: 2024-08-02 14:29:16

C语言变量和函数命名规范的相关文章

C++学习笔记5:如何给变量及函数命名?

1.遵循C++规定的变量及函数命名方法: 2.原则:简单,易于理解: 以下是一些例子,可以作为参考: //bad examples: int ccount;//Nobody knows what a ccount is. int i;//Generally bad unless use is trivial or temporary, such as loop variables. int _count;//don't start variable names with underscore.

JS——变量声明、变量类型、命名规范

变量声明: JavaScript是一种弱类型语言,它的变量类型由它的值来决定,var是变量声明. 变量类型: 基本类型:number.string.boolean(布尔类型:var a=true/false;).undefined(未定义类型: var a;).null(空对象类型var ) 复合类型:object(对象类型) 命名规范: 1)区分大小写 2)第一个字符必须是字母.下划线.美元符号$ 3)其他字符可以是字母.下划线.美元或者数字 原文地址:https://www.cnblogs.

c语言基础数据类型及命名规范

1. 常量是程序运行期间不能被改变的量; 变量代表一个存储区域,存储区域内存储的内容就是变量的值, 变量的值可以在程序运行期间改变  (变量就像一个杯子, 用来存放水, 杯子里的水即变量的值是可以改变的) 2.基本数据类型:int: 整型类型, 在内存中占4个字节, 在计算机中每个字节都由8个二进位制数表示; short: 短整型类型, 在内存中占2个字节 long: 长整型类型, 在内存中占4或8个字节, 和操作系统有关, 在32位的操作系统中占4个字节, 在64位的操作系统中占8个字节 fl

Javascript变量前缀的命名规范

类型 前缀 类型 实例 数组 a Array   布尔值 b Boolean   浮点型(小数) f Float   函数 fn Function   整数 i Integer   对象 o Object   正则表达式 r RegExp   字符串 s String   变体变量 v Variant  

Python带_的变量或函数命名

python中的标识符可以包含数字.字母和_,但必须以字母或者_开头,其中以_开头的命名一般具有特殊的意义. 前后均带有双下划线__的命名 一般用于特殊方法的命名,用来实现对象的一些行为或者功能,比如__new__()方法用来创建实例,__init__()方法用来初始化对象, x + y操作被映射为方法x.__add__(y),序列或者字典的索引操作x[k]映射为x.__getitem__(k),__len__().__str__()分别被内置函数len().str()调用等等. 仅开头带双下划

【Java】变量命名规范

Java是一种区分字母的大小写的语言,所以我们在定义变量名的时候应该注意区分大小写的使用和一些规范,接下来我们简单的来讲讲Java语言中包.类.变量等的命名规范. (一)Package(包)的命名 Package的名字应该都是由一个小写单词组成,例如com.xuetang9.company等. (二)Class(类)的命名 Class的名字首字母大写,通常由多个单词合成一个类名,要求每个单词的首字母也要大写,例如:XueTang或ProNine. (三)变量的命名 变量的名字可大小写混用,但首字

关于方法、变量、类等命名规范

做一个规范的程序员 0.0. ------------------------------------------------------------------------------------ * 变量和常量命名规范: * 所有变量.方法.类名:见名知意 * 类成员变量.局部变量.package包命名:首字母小写和驼峰原则:monthSalary * 类名:首字母大写和驼峰原则:Man,GoodMan * 方法名(函数):首字母小写和驼峰原则:run(),runFast(): * 常量:大

关于如何给变量函数命名

一位google创作语言的工程师讲的非常好,详见 https://mp.weixin.qq.com/s/xRB5fy4KkZN9ziJUrpG8PQ 我会在下面总结一下 变量函数命名是基本功,不要忽略这些细节,在大公司里写代码可不是能实现基本功能就行了. 回到正题,总结: 1,变量的命名不要带上其数据类型中就已经说明的信息 如List<String> strings 就很好,不要写成List<String> stringList 2,函数的命名不要带上其参数列表中已经说明的信息,

JAVA中变量的类型及命名规范

1. 计算机是一种极度精确的机器;2. 要将信息存储在计算机当中,就必须指明信息存储的位置和所需的内存空间;3. 在JAVA编程语言当中,使用声明语句来完成上述的任务; 4. 变量的类型: 5. 变量名的命名规范: